Question:

Which is incorrect about non-chordates ?

Options:

Gill slits are absent.

Post anal tail is absent.

Heart is dorsal.

Central nervous system is ventral, hollow and double.

Correct Answer:

Central nervous system is ventral, hollow and double.

Explanation:

The correct answer is Option (4) -Central nervous system is ventral, hollow and double.

Animals belonging to phylum Chordata are fundamentally characterised by the presence of a notochord, a dorsal hollow nerve cord and paired pharyngeal gill slits . These are bilaterally symmetrical, triploblastic, coelomate with organ-system level of organisation. They possess a post anal tail and a closed circulatory system.
